4-5-1 Extension Chip Data
Applicable pin information of chip is checked and corrected.
1. Press Exten chip .
Pin Missing ............... Select the side to indicate missing pin data
(Every pressing this changes the side as 1 2 3 4 1.)
Pin Skip input............ Specifying the number of pin on the indicated side sets pin present or
pin missing in turn.
All pin clear ............... All data of missing pin on the indicated side is cleared.

4-5-2 Selecting the Nozzle
Nozzle name is selected.
1. Press Nzl select on chip data screen.
Check the shape and select the nozzle name.
4-5-3 Selecting REF
Object chip is selected.
1. Press REF select on the chip data
screen.
Check the shape and select object chip.
Corresponding REF number is entered.
